Why do speakers emphasize particular words and phrases?
Vinvika [58]

Answer: To make the language more memorable

Explanation:

In speech, we often emphasize certain words which carry an important message. This is often done by politicians and professional speakers who deliver their speech in front of a mass of people. In doing so, we are hoping that our audience remembers the speech and the ideas we are trying to convey. By emphasizing our words and phrases, our speech is more persuasive.
